摘要:This study aimed to use floating photobioreactor (PBR) to produce microalgae biomass for aquaculture applications, and this was tested with cultivation of Isochrysis zhangjiangensis. The highest cell density of 16.1 +/- 0.61 x 10(6) cell L-1 was obtained in an outdoor culture with a depth of 5.0 cm in 1.0 m(2) floating PBR, but deeper culture resulted in higher biomass productivity. Large-scale cultivation at size of 10 m(2) (1000 L) produced the highest cell density of 17.8 x 106 cell L-1 and highest biomass productivity of 0.115 g L-1 d(-1), which was at the same level as that for flat-panel PBR (100 L). This developed technique provides an innovative approach to produce microalgae on site for use as fresh aquaculture feed, as well as fresh cells for use as seed inoculums for large-area aquaculture water bodies. This approach provides not only a low-cost microalgae production system but also better integration between microalgae production and aquaculture.
